Chardonnay grape harvest at Hambledon Vineyard and winery, Hampshire, UK Wednesday October 7, 2020. Hambledon has 100,00 established vines situated on 200acres of chalk downland. The UK has 3,500 hectares of planted vines, producing million bottles dominated by sparkling wine. Famous champagne houses Pommery and Taittinger have both bought land in England.
